在日常运维中,正确地关机是确保系统安全和数据完整的重要步骤。在这里,我们将详细解释如何在CentOS 7.6上正确地关闭系统。本文将介绍几种常用的关机命令及其参数,以帮助你更好地管理你的CentOS 7系统。

一、使用shutdown命令

最常用的关机命令是「shutdown」。这个命令可以让你安全地关闭系统,同时会通知所有登录用户。其基本语法如下:

shutdown [选项] [时间] [警告信息]

其中,选项和时间是可选的。常见的选项包括:

-h:关机并关闭电源。

-r:重启系统。

-c:取消正在进行的关机。

例如,如果你想立即关机并发送警告信息给所有用户,可以使用以下命令:

shutdown -h now 系统即将关机,请保存您的工作!

如果希望设定一个时间,像是几分钟后关机,可以这样写:

shutdown -h +5 系统将在5分钟后关机,请保存您的工作!

二、使用poweroff命令

另一个常用的关机命令是「poweroff」。它的功能相对简单,就是立即关机并关闭电源。可以直接在终端输入:

poweroff

这个命令会立即执行关机,不会给用户任何警告,因此建议在确认没有其他重要操作时使用。

三、使用halt命令

同样,halt命令也可用于关机。与poweroff类似,halt命令将停止所有运行的进程,但不一定会关闭电源。可以通过如下命令进行关机:

halt

这也会立即停止系统,并结束所有的进程。

四、使用init命令

还有一个高级的关机方式是通过init命令。这个命令用于改变系统的运行级别,您可以将其用于安全地关机。具体使用如下:

init 0

这条命令将把系统的运行级别更改为0,表示关机状态,系统将被安全关闭。

五、注意事项

在使用关机命令时,有几点需要注意:

CentOS 7.6关机命令详解:如何正确关闭CentOS 7系统图1

确保所有用户已经保存他们的工作,并且重要进程已经结束。

尽量使用带有警告信息的关机命令,以便其他用户能够得到通知。

在生产环境中,建议使用shutdown命令,并设置适当的延迟时间。

此外,对于远程系统的关机,建议通过SSH连接到服务器后,再执行相关的关闭命令,以确保操作的安全性和准确性。

结语

正确地关闭CentOS 7.6系统可以有效避免数据损失和文件系统损坏。在日常使用中,应根据具体情况选择适合的关机命令,并始终通知相关用户。希望通过本篇文章,能够帮助您更好地掌握CentOS 7系统的关机技巧。